STRETCHED INTEGRITY
So many images flying about.
So much that staked a wizardry
inclusive of our trying to find something remarkable.
Not enough of all this to go around.
Or too much, too much that flies off.
Just wield your stretched integrity as best you can.
I might try to find myself included in your circus.
The re-adjustment that flies in the face of chasms
that have never been fully explored.
This ceremony we have concocted scrambles
the newfound itineraries of shame. Exaggerated,
the outcall that mangles infamy. The torrid
witless torment of these unrequited timings.
Just have your say, your way, your time
here with such uncertain consequences.
The psyche is serious business, watch
where you are going.
--Bill Pearlman
1-5-2012
